/*  CREATION, DESIGN & MANUAL CODING BY POLARIS CREATIVE BACKLINE vof - ALL RIGHTS RESERVED  */


/* COMMON ELEMENTS */
A:LINK	{text-decoration: none; color: #96A3B5;}
A:VISITED  {text-decoration: none; color: #96A3B5;}
A:HOVER	{text-decoration: none; color: #C0CCDD;}

A:LINK.col {text-decoration: none; font-weight:bold; color: #2690C3;}
A:VISITED.col {text-decoration: none; font-weight:bold; color: #207AA6;}
A:HOVER.col {text-decoration: underline; font-weight:bold; color: #2690C3;}

A:LINK.mnsa	{text-decoration: none; color: #cccccc;}
A:VISITED.mnsa {text-decoration: none; color: #cccccc;}
A:HOVER.mnsa {text-decoration: none; color: #96A3B5;}

SELECT,INPUT {position:absolute; background: #C0C7D3; font-size:8pt; color: #4A4A4A; border: dashed #ffffff;  border-width: 1px 1px 1px 1px; }

DIV.box {position:absolute; left:10px;   width:756px; height:30px; overflow: hidden; background-color: #A6B4C2;}
DIV.nws {position:absolute; left:50px;   top:40px;    width:650px; overflow: hidden; background-color: #A6B4C2;}


.mnf  {position:absolute; top:5px; font-size: 8pt; color: #96A3B5; text-align:center;}
.mns  {position:absolute; top:0px; left:20px; font-size: 8pt; color: #96A3B5; text-align:center;}
.mnl  {position:absolute; width:1px; height:25px;}

.dir {position:absolute; top:7px; left:50px; font-size: 7pt; font-family: verdana,sans-serif; color: #96A3B5;}

DIV.agndrow {position:absolute; left:-20px; width:756px; height:25px; font-size: 8pt;         color: #ffffff;}
.agndtab    {position:absolute; top:0px;                 height:25px; border: solid #cccccc;  border-width: 0px 1px 0px 0px; text-indent: 10px; line-height: 24px;}
.agndtabn   {position:absolute; top:0px;                 height:25px; border: solid #cccccc;  border-width: 0px 1px 0px 0px; color:#748397; text-indent: 10px; line-height: 24px;}
.agndday		{position:absolute; left:40px;  width:660px; height:85px; border: dashed #cccccc; border-width: 1px 1px 1px 1px; overflow:visible; visibility:hidden;}

.inpt {position:absolute; background: #C0C7D3; font-size:8pt; color: #7D8B9F; font-weight: bold; border: dashed #ffffff;  border-width: 1px 1px 1px 1px; }

.newstme {position:relative; width:650px; left:10px; font-size: 8pt; color: #444444; line-height:18px; font-family: Trebuchet, Trebuchet MS, Tahoma, Verdana, Arial, sans-serif; font-weight:bold; }
.newstle {color: #ffffff; } /*#008AC9*/
.newsbar {position:relative; left:-20px; width:756px; background:#92A0AE; }
.newstxt {position:relative; left:45px; width:665px; font-size: 8pt; color: #ffffff; padding:2px 5px 5px 5px;}

.select {position:absolute; background: #A1A9BB; font-size:8pt;  border: 1px #000000; color:#00494F;  border-style: dashed dashed dashed dashed;  border-width: 1px 1px 1px 1px;  border-color: #000000 #000000 #000000 #000000;  }

.pt8col {font-size: 8pt;  font-family: Tahoma,sans-serif; color: #2690C3; }
.pt7col {font-size: 7pt;  font-family: Tahoma,sans-serif; color: #2690C3; }
.tle2   {font-size: 12pt; font-family: Tahoma,sans-serif; color: #000000; font-weight:bold; }

.treb7col {font-family: Trebuchet MS,Trebuchet,Tahoma,Times New Roman; font-size:7pt; color:#2690C3; }
.treb8col {font-family: Trebuchet MS,Trebuchet,Tahoma,Times New Roman; font-size:8pt; color:#2690C3; }
.treb9col {font-family: Trebuchet MS,Trebuchet,Tahoma,Times New Roman; font-size:9pt; color:#2690C3; }
.treb10col{font-family: Trebuchet MS,Trebuchet,Tahoma,Times New Roman; font-size:10pt; color:#2690C3; }



